SETTINGS USED IN THIS TUTORIAL

Magic Wand:

Mode: Add/Shift, Match Mode: RGB Value, Tolerance 0, Contiguous checked, Feather: 0, Anti-Alias checked and outside selected.

Drop Shadow:

Vertical Offset 2, Horizontal Offset 2, Opacity 80, Blur 5, Color Black

Step 1

Open up the double picture frame psp file and your tube graphics.

Step 2

Go to Layers/New Raster Layer and flood fill this layer with white.  Go to Layers/Arrange Send to bottom.

Step 3

Open up the layer palette and make sure you are on the top layer (the layer with the double picture frame).

Go to Adjust/Hue and Saturation/Colorize and move the sliders to obtain a color for your frame that will work well with both of your tube images. Once you colorize your frame, the inside portion will be a lighter shade, surrounded by a darker shade of the same color family.  The outside portion of the frame should remain black.

Step 4

Left click magic wand and use the settings from above.  Left click the magic wand on the interior portion of one of the frames. 

Step 5

Make one of your tube graphics active and go to Edit/Copy.  Make the tag image active and go to Edit/Paste as New Layer.  Do not deselect.

If the tube image is too large to fit within the frame, go to Image/Resize using the percent option, bicubic and resize all layers NOT checked.

Step 6

Left click the mover tool and place the image within the frame.  Go to Selections/Invert, click the delete key and go to Selections/Select None.

Step 7

Open up the layer palette and locate the double frame layer.  Left click the magic wand inside the remaining frame.  Open up the layer palette and make sure you are on the top layer.

Step 8

Make your second tube graphic active and Repeat Steps 5 and 6.

Step 9

Go to Layers/Merge/Merge Visible.

Step 10

Open up your flower presets. There are various sizes of flowers that you can use for this tutorial or use as accents for other tags.  Go to the layer with the smallest flower and go to Edit/Copy.  Make your tag active and go to Edit/Paste as New Layer.  Move the small flower to the top of the frame as you see on mine.  Colorize your flower so that it works well with your frame.

Step 11

Go back to the flower tube and select a larger size flower for the bottom of the frame.  Copy and paste it and colorize the flower either the same color or a different color.  Add the drop shadow setting from above.

Go to Layers/Duplicate and move the flower next to the first.   Go to Layers/Duplicate once more and move the third flower over next to the second one.

What I did was made the middle flower just a bit smaller by going to Image/Resize using the percent option at 95%, bicubic and resize all layers NOT checked.

Go to Layers/Merge/Merge Visible.

Step 12

Add your copyright information and your text to the tag. 

Go to Layers/Merge/Merge Visible.

Step 13

Go to Image/Resize using the percent option at 80%, bicubic and resize all layers checked.

Step 14

Go to Layers/Duplicate.  Do this 6 more times so you have a total of 7 layers.  Save this file as a psp or psd file.
